Working Principle of the Lightweight Calcium Carbonate Powder Conveying Line

The conveying line for lightweight calcium carbonate powder operates on a combination of mechanical and pneumatic principles to ensure safe and efficient material transport. The system typically begins with a hopper or storage silo where the LCC powder is stored. From there, the powder is fed into a series of components that facilitate its movement through the system. The primary mechanism involves a combination of rotary valves, conveyor belts, and air-assisted devices to move the powder from the storage area to the processing or packaging stages. The rotary valves control the flow rate and direction of the powder, while the conveyor belts provide continuous movement along the designated path. Air-assisted components, such as pneumatic conveyors or air slides, help to reduce friction and prevent material buildup, ensuring smooth and consistent transport. The entire system is designed to handle the low density and fine particle size of LCC powder, which can be challenging for traditional conveying methods. By integrating these components, the conveying line achieves a high level of efficiency and reliability in moving the material through the production process.

Key Features of the Lightweight Calcium Carbonate Powder Conveying Line

Shandong HeadPowder Engineering Co., Ltd. has developed a conveying line that incorporates several advanced features to enhance performance and user experience. One of the most notable features is the use of high-efficiency rotary valves, which are specifically designed to handle fine powders without causing blockages or degradation. These valves are equipped with anti-static coatings to prevent powder accumulation and ensure consistent flow. The conveyor system utilizes a combination of belt types, including flexible and rigid options, to accommodate different powder characteristics and operating conditions. The air-assisted components are equipped with adjustable air pressure controls, allowing operators to optimize the conveying rate based on the specific requirements of the LCC powder. This flexibility ensures that the system can handle varying production volumes and material properties without compromising performance. Additionally, the conveying line is designed with easy access points for maintenance and cleaning, reducing downtime and maintenance costs. The system also includes monitoring and control features, such as flow meters and pressure sensors, to provide real-time feedback on the conveying process. This allows for immediate adjustments to be made if any issues arise, ensuring optimal operation. The overall design emphasizes durability and low maintenance, making it suitable for continuous industrial use. The use of high-quality materials and precision engineering ensures that the conveying line can withstand the demands of long-term operation in various industrial environments.
